Ray -- You should consider a good detailing job on the hull before making the decision to apply bottom paint. If, like me, you are an old guy you can hire someone to wash the boat and compound it with particular attention to the discolored area. Follow that with a good wax job with quality wax such as Collinite. I would not allow anyone to use a power buffer for the work unless they are professionals.

At the end of the day if you decide to apply paint you don't need to apply an expensive barrier coat and anti-fouling paint. Just a decent brushable topside paint will hide any discoloration.
